探索GitHub的免费应用程序:功能、优势与使用指南

GitHub是全球最大的代码托管平台之一,凭借其强大的功能和庞大的开发者社区,成为无数程序员和开发者的首选。在GitHub上,有许多免费应用程序可以帮助开发者提高工作效率、管理项目、增强代码质量等。本文将详细介绍GitHub的免费应用,包括其功能、优势以及使用指南。

什么是GitHub免费应用?

GitHub免费应用指的是在GitHub平台上提供的各种应用和工具,旨在帮助开发者更好地管理代码库、协作开发和进行项目管理。这些应用可以直接与GitHub集成,提供额外的功能和服务。

GitHub免费应用的功能

1. 项目管理

  • 任务跟踪:许多应用提供任务管理功能,可以帮助团队分配和跟踪任务。
  • 进度报告:生成可视化的进度报告,便于团队了解项目进展。

2. 代码审查

  • 自动化审查:一些应用能够自动检查代码的质量,发现潜在的bug。
  • 集成评论:开发者可以直接在代码上添加评论,方便交流。

3. CI/CD集成

  • 持续集成:一些应用可以与CI工具集成,实现自动构建和测试。
  • 自动部署:通过简单配置,实现代码自动部署到生产环境。

4. 文档生成

  • 自动生成文档:通过应用自动生成API文档,减少人工维护的工作。
  • 版本控制:文档也可以通过Git进行版本控制。

5. 安全性提升

  • 安全审计:应用可以检测代码库中的安全漏洞,及时通知开发者。
  • 依赖管理:帮助开发者管理项目中的依赖,确保安全性。

GitHub免费应用的优势

1. 提高开发效率

使用GitHub的免费应用,可以显著提高开发效率,减少人工操作,提高工作流的自动化程度。

2. 加强团队协作

应用提供的协作工具,可以帮助团队成员更好地沟通,减少误解,提高工作效率。

3. 降低开发成本

大多数GitHub免费应用都不需要额外付费,企业和个人开发者都可以享受这些功能,从而降低了开发成本。

4. 丰富的社区支持

GitHub拥有庞大的开发者社区,许多免费应用都有活跃的支持社区,能够提供即时的帮助和反馈。

如何使用GitHub免费应用

1. 注册GitHub账号

首先,您需要拥有一个GitHub账号,如果没有,可以访问GitHub官网进行注册。

2. 浏览GitHub应用市场

在GitHub的应用市场中,您可以浏览各种免费应用,根据需要选择合适的工具。

3. 安装和配置应用

根据应用的使用说明,进行安装和配置,以便与您的项目集成。

4. 参与社区

使用过程中,如遇问题,可以参与相关的社区讨论,获取更多帮助。

常见问题解答(FAQ)

GitHub免费应用有哪些?

  • GitHub上有很多免费应用,如Travis CIDependabotCodeQL等,它们分别用于CI/CD、依赖管理和代码审查等功能。

如何找到适合我的GitHub应用?

  • 您可以在GitHub Marketplace中根据类别和关键词进行搜索,以找到适合您项目的应用。

GitHub免费应用对开源项目有什么帮助?

  • 对于开源项目,GitHub免费应用可以帮助开发者更好地管理项目,吸引贡献者,提升代码质量。

安装GitHub免费应用是否复杂?

  • 一般情况下,安装GitHub免费应用非常简单,大多数应用都提供详细的安装和配置说明。

是否所有的GitHub应用都是免费的?

  • 并不是所有应用都是免费的,虽然GitHub上有许多免费应用,但也有一些应用需要付费订阅才能享受高级功能。

总结

通过使用GitHub的免费应用,开发者能够更高效地管理代码、加强团队合作,并提升代码质量。这些应用的功能多样,可以根据项目需求选择合适的工具,从而在竞争激烈的开发环境中立于不败之地。希望本文能够帮助您更好地理解和利用GitHub的免费应用!

正文完